What is a Registered Representative?
A designated agent is an person or a corporate entity designated to receive crucial official and financial documents on for a business. This role is crucial in ensuring that a business remains compliant with state legislation and rules. Registered agents act as the official point of communication between the company and the state government, handling documents such as service of process, annual reports, and tax filings.
The responsibilities of a designated agent include receiving legal documents, making sure they are delivered to the correct parties within the business, and monitoring important deadlines. This service enables businesses to maintain good standing with state authorities, avoiding penalties and legal complications that may arise from overlooked filings or notifications. By having a designated agent, businesses can concentrate on their operations while making certain they meet all statutory obligations.
Registered agents must meet specific requirements based on state regulations. They usually need to be residents of the state where the company is incorporated or registered, or be a registered agent company authorized to function in that state. Perks of Hiring a Registered Agent
An important benefit of utilizing a professional agent is that it guarantees legal compliance for your business. A registered agent is tasked with receiving significant legal documents, such as legal notices and tax documents, on behalf of your enterprise. This ensures that you don’t neglect essential timelines or significant legal communications, which can result in sanctions or even the decline of good standing with the state. By employing a registered agent, you can focus on managing your company knowing that all legal alerts are being handled efficiently.
A further advantage is the enhanced security a registered agent provides. Business owners who serve as their own registered agents may face their personal information listed in public records, putting them to potential risks. A professional agent provides a level of distance, allowing you to keep your personal information private while maintaining adherence with regulatory obligations. This is especially significant for individuals who work from home or would like to keep their personal and business matters separate.
Furthermore, hiring a professional agent can promote more streamlined management of business documents and compliance notifications. Professional agent services often feature benefits such as mail forwarding and document handling, allowing you to handle essential mail in a timely fashion. Many professional agents also offer digital platforms for convenient access to documents and alerts for compliance deadlines, which helps enhance your business operations and lowers the chance of legal problems.

Business Agent Requirements and Responsibilities
When creating a company, understanding the agent stipulations is important for compliance and legal processes. A statutory agent must be a resident of the state where the business is incorporated or a entity permitted to operate within that state. This agent or entity acts as the appointed point of contact for handling official documents, such as legal notifications and government notices. It is vital for companies to ensure their registered agent meets the specific requirements outlined by state laws, which may consist of maintaining a physical address and being available during standard working hours.
The responsibilities of a statutory agent extend past just accepting official notices. They play a critical role in upholding adherence by forwarding important documents to the entity in a efficient manner. This consists of yearly filings, tax documents, and other essential correspondences from the government. An adequate agent of record also provides notifications for regulatory deadlines, helping organizations avoid risk of penalties for untimely reports or overdue filings. Thus, their role is essential to overall organizational management and effective operations.

Cost of Professional Agent Services
The price of registered agent services can differ considerably depending on multiple factors, including the provider's credibility, the services provided, and location-based context. Typically, entities can count on to invest ranging from $50 to $300 per year for a professional agent, with most reputable services falling in the bracket of $100 to $200. This cost often includes extra amenities such as reminders for compliance, mail services, and utilization of online portals for document management.
When assessing agent options, it is crucial to factor in what is offered in the fees. Some agent providers offer fundamental services at a lower cost, but may add fees for essential features like seasonal compliance submissions or corporate address services. Ways to Update Your Registered Agent
Changing your registered agent is a vital step in ensuring your business's compliance with state regulations. Make sure the new agent can carry out statutory obligations, including processing service of process and maintaining compliance notifications.
Once you have selected a replacement registered agent, you will need to fill out the necessary paperwork to formally change your agent of record. This generally involves filling out a registered agent change form unique to your state. Some states may demand a signed consent form from the new registered agent to verify they agree to take on the responsibilities. It's vital to submit this paperwork to the appropriate state agency, such as the Secretary of State's office, and cover any associated fees for the change.
Ultimately, after your application is accepted and your updated registered agent is officially designated, advise your previous registered agent of the change. It is also beneficial to refresh your business records and update relevant stakeholders of the new registered agent's details.
